Motorsport Engineering BEng Program Overview

The Motorsport Engineering BEng (Hons) at Coventry University focuses on the low-volume, high-performance world of motorsport engineering, preparing you with the versatility and depth of understanding to tackle new and unusual engineering challenges. The program covers design for performance, construction, and operation of competition vehicles alongside core mechanical engineering topics, providing a sound understanding of the professional context of motorsport engineering.

Teaching is highly practical, combining lecture-based knowledge with hands-on design, experimentation, analysis, and practical skills through live industry projects and international student competitions such as the IMechE Formula Student competition. You will train using facilities including a Mercedes-AMG wind tunnel, a 6DoF driving simulator, engine and chassis dynamometers, a VR Power Wall, and composites labs that mirror professional motorsport engineering environments.

The program features a common first year shared with Automotive and Mechanical Engineering courses, giving you a broad grounding before specialising in motorsport-specific modules in years two and three. Coventry University holds strong ties with industry leaders such as Jaguar Land Rover, Lotus, and Prodrive, and graduates have secured positions with teams including Red Bull Racing, Mercedes HPP, McLaren Automotive, and Alpine F1.

Curriculum and Modules

The Motorsport Engineering BEng curriculum is structured across three years, with 120 UK credits per year. Year one provides a shared engineering foundation, while years two and three deliver specialist motorsport modules covering aerodynamics, vehicle dynamics, powertrain systems, and a capstone individual project.

Mechanical Science

20 credits

Explore how things move and behave under force by applying Newton's laws of motion, understand how materials respond under stress, and develop shear force and bending moment diagrams for different beam loading scenarios alongside core thermofluids principles.

Engineering Design

20 credits

Develop fundamental engineering design skills using CAD tools and learn to take a design concept through a development process considering costs, simulation, analysis, materials, and manufacturing processes.

Motorsport Aerodynamics and Vehicle Dynamics

20 credits

Study the aerodynamic principles and vehicle dynamics that govern competition vehicle performance, applying CFD simulation and wind tunnel testing techniques used in professional motorsport engineering.

Motorsport Powertrain

20 credits

Explore the design, testing, and optimisation of high-performance powertrain systems for competition vehicles, including engine performance, electrified propulsion, and calibration engineering.

Finite Element Analysis and Vehicle Structures

20 credits

Gain practical experience with industry-standard FEA software to model, analyse, and simulate vehicle structural components, exploring how vehicle structures influence durability, reliability, and refinement.

Individual Project (BEng)

20 credits

Work on a large final-year project in an area of personal interest with the support of a mentor, applying research, design, and analysis skills to solve a real-world motorsport engineering problem.

Admission Requirements

Entry to the Motorsport Engineering BEng (Hons) program requires a strong background in mathematics and science. The program welcomes applications from students with a range of international qualifications. Contact Uni4Edu for a personalised assessment of your eligibility.

Academic Requirements

  • A LevelsABB-BBB including Mathematics and one from Physics, Chemistry, Design Technology, Further Mathematics, Electronics, or Engineering
  • BTECDDM in an Engineering subject including a Distinction in the Further Engineering Mathematics unit
  • International BaccalaureateOverall pass including at least 15 points from three HL subjects, one of which must be Mathematics with a minimum of 5 points
  • GCSE Requirement5 GCSEs at grade 4/C or above including English and Mathematics
  • Access to HE Diploma30 Level 3 credits at Distinction and 15 Level 3 credits at Merit in Mathematics or Physical Science units, plus GCSE English and Mathematics at grade 4/C

Scholarships & Funding

Coventry University offers several scholarship opportunities for international students to help reduce the cost of studying Motorsport Engineering. These awards are available to self-funded international students and are applied as tuition fee reductions. Contact Uni4Edu for full eligibility details and application guidance.

Vice-Chancellor Undergraduate Scholarship

Up to GBP 4,000 off a 3-year degree

Available to self-funded international students (excluding EU) starting a full-time undergraduate degree. The scholarship is applied as a tuition fee reduction across the duration of the program.

Coventry University Group Scholarship

GBP 2,000 per year (up to GBP 6,000 total)

Available to self-funded international students for the 2026/27 academic year, this scholarship provides a GBP 2,000 annual tuition fee reduction for each year of undergraduate study at any Coventry University Group UK campus.

EU Support Bursary

Tuition fee reduction to UK student rate

Available to EU-resident students starting a full-time undergraduate course, this bursary automatically reduces tuition fees to align with UK student rates for all years up to and including the 2026/27 academic year.
